    When Adobe posts an update to Adobe Flash Player, they typically recommend that affected users of any systems that use Adobe Flash apply the update. Adobe Flash Player is provided as an integral part of the BlackBerry Tablet OS installation. This means that the Adobe Flash Player update is packaged in the latest BlackBerry Tablet OS update ...

    Mar 07, 2015 · When it was announced BlackBerry OS 10.3.1 would drop Adobe Flash support, some folks were upset but given the fact even Adobe doesn't support Flash on mobile anymore it wasn't entirely unexpected. Still, many folks rely on Adobe Flash and having it built into the native BlackBerry 10 browser was a bonus for those who needed it and since its removal, folks have been looking for the best...

    Dec 30, 2014 · During this time Adobe has stopped Flash development support for mobile browsers. This is consistent with the shift of mobile web content generally moving towards HTML5. As a result, we can no longer support Adobe Flash beginning with the upcoming software release of BlackBerry …
